hash_update()
(PHP 5 >= 5.1.2, PHP 7, PECL hash >= 1.1)
向活跃的哈希运算上下文中填充数据
说明
hash_update(HashContext$context,string $data): bool
参数
- $context
由hash_init()函数返回的哈希运算上下文。
- $data
要向哈希摘要中追加的数据。
返回值
返回TRUE
。
更新日志
版本 | 说明 |
---|---|
7.2.0 | 接收参数从资源类型修改为HashContext对象类型。 |

A simple example on incremental file hashing: $fp = fopen($file, "r"); $ctx = hash_init('sha256'); while (!feof($fp)) { $buffer = fgets($fp, 65536); hash_update($ctx, $buffer); } $hash = hash_final($ctx, true); fclose($fp); While incremental hashing is quite slow, it's the easiest way to hash - parts of large files: I.e., a 700MB avi video uses first x bytes to store metadata, so in order to hash the avi's data only, you have to fseek to data start and use incremental hashing - streaming data if php just proxies the data - whenever it's inadequate or impossible to store the data being hashed into memory (i.e. because of their size) or on disc.
